Add a pinch of solid NaF, side shelf, to test tube 4 and mix well. Observe color changes. Fluoride reacts and coordinates with Fe3+, thus removing it from participating in the equilibrium reaction. Fe3+ (aq) + 6 F-(aq) → [FeF6]-3 (aq) Eq 3 6. Place test tube 5 in the hot water bath. Place test tube 6 in the ice water bath. Web14 okt. 2016 · Explanation: Endothermic: The chemical reactions in which reactants form products by absorption of energy are called as endothermic reactions. Exothermic : The chemical reactions in which reactants form products along with release of energy are called as exothermic reactions. Thus if walls turn hot that means the energy has been released.
